627805 2008-01-07 04:23:00 If you are talking 1/4" square, if i remember right the old Triumph Heralds had those (and some other Pommy cars of similar vintage), go ask your local vintage/veteran car clubs or look out for any swap meets in your area: maybe you could modify a lever type house door handle (screw a twistable knob to the end), they are 1/4" square drive I think. feersumendjinn (64)

627809 2008-01-09 06:22:00 Just use any handle that will fit over the square shaft and drill a hole through both and attach with a pin or small bolt. Safari (3993)
